What is Karkatshringi?

Karkatshringi or Shikari is a multibranched tree. It is a tree with Srngi (gall) like structures on it that are produced by an insect called Aphis (Dasia asdifactor). These horn-like outgrowths are called as Karkatshringi. These are large, hollow and cylindrical in shape and are packed with medicinal properties.

What is Ayurveda Ativisha?

Ativisha – Aconitum heterophyllum is an Ayurveda herb, especially used in diseases of children. Charaka has declared – Of all the herbs having digestive, carminative, absorbent and Tridosha balancing properties, Ativisha is the best. Botanical name is Aconitum heterophyllum Wall.

What is Bharangi?

Bharangi is a one of the common herbs used in the treatment of common cold, chronic sinusitis, allergic rhinitis, cough and other chronic respiratory problems. It is also an excellent dry cough home remedy. It is also used by Ayurveda for relief from fever and hyper-pyrexia.

What is Kasamarda?

Kasamarda – Cassia occidentalis Linn, is used as an aphrodisiac. It improves digestion, cleanses throat, useful in cough, balances all the three Doshas and more. It is also called Negro coffee and coffee senna, coffee weed as its seeds are used in place of coffee in some places.

What is Bhallataka?

Bhallataka, commonly known as Marking nut is one of the most widely used herb in Ayurvedic treatments. The name Bhallataka means that the plant is very sharp like that of spear. The word semecarpus meant for the black juice of the nut which is used for making or tracing designs upon clothes.

What is Daruhaldi?

Daruhaldi powder is made from the roots of Berberis aristata. It has antioxidant, antibacterial, anti-inflammatory, antipyretic, antiseptic, diuretic, anti-lipidemic & immuno-modulatory properties.

What is Kakamachi?

Kakamachi (Solanum nigrum Linn), Solanaceae family, is a prominent herb in Ayurveda which is used as food and medicine since long ago.

What is Mandur Bhasma?

Mandur Bhasma, also spelled as Mandoor Bhasma is an ayurvedic proprietary medication comprising of calcined iron and mainly indicated for the purpose of treating and managing iron deficiency anemia (i.e., microcytic anemia) and the underlying debility associated with it.
